EURAMET Project 924 Workshop on uncertainty estimations, 9.-10. April 2008, PTB, Braunschweig

 

This workshop is organised in the framework of a meeting of the EURAMET project 924 "Development of a sustainable traceability and dissemination system providing Europe-wide comparable measurement results in water monitoring under the WFD (2000/60/EC)". It is directed to reference laboratories and should provide the means for the calculation of "bottom up" uncertainty budgets according to GUM. The calculation of uncertainties for measurement results of three different methods (AFS, GFAAS, ICP MS) of inorganic elements which belong to the priority list of substances of the WFD will be shown.
